Are There Free Walking Tours in Frederikssund?
Based on current verifiable data, regularly scheduled free walking tours operated by independent, tip-based guiding companies are not a common offering in Frederikssund, Denmark. Frederikssund, a smaller municipality known for its Viking heritage and fjord landscape, typically focuses on local attractions, museums (like J.F. Willumsen Museum), and self-guided exploration rather than extensive international tourist-oriented free walking tour networks found in larger cities. Visitors often explore the town independently or seek out specific guided experiences offered by local institutions or during special events.

General Tips for Joining Free Walking Tours (Applicable Elsewhere)
If you encounter free walking tours in other locations or if a local initiative begins in Frederikssund, here are some general tips:
- Book Ahead: Many tours require online registration to manage group sizes.
- Arrive Early: Be at the meeting point 10-15 minutes before the start time.
- Wear Comfortable Shoes: Tours typically involve 2-3 hours of walking.
- Bring Water: Stay hydrated, especially during warmer months.
- Tip Your Guide: “Free” tours are tip-based. Guides rely on gratuities (typically €10-€20 or DKK 75-150 per person, estimated range based on tour quality and duration).
What to Expect from a Free Walking Tour (General Format)
A typical free walking tour, as offered in many cities worldwide, usually involves:
- Duration: Approximately 2 to 3 hours.
- Group Size: Varies from small groups (10-15 people) to larger groups (20-30+).
- Local Guides: Knowledgeable locals who provide historical context, cultural insights, and personal anecdotes.
- Meeting Points: Easily accessible central locations, often near major landmarks.
- Language: Primarily conducted in English, with some tours offering other languages.
